AI Technical Summary
Copper enamel decorative parts are worn against the metal hanging rings under the influence of wind, resulting in the destruction of the oxide protective layer and reducing the life of the decorative parts.
A protective assembly including an isolation sleeve, an isolation pad and a positioning column was designed. It was installed on the copper base through a hanging hole, and an oxidation protective layer and an anti-corrosion protective layer were coated on the surface of the copper base, and an enamel pattern was coated with an enamel protective layer to achieve double isolation protection.
It effectively prevents the copper base and metal hanging ring from wearing out, prolongs the service life of decorative parts and improves corrosion resistance.

TECHNICAL FIELD
[0001] The utility model relates to ancient building technical field, concretely is copper body enamel decoration for ancient building cultural relics restoration. BACKGROUND
[0002] Copper body enamel decoration piece often uses metal hanging ring to hang under the eave of ancient building, to improve the appearance of ancient building, when the copper body enamel decoration piece on the ancient building is repaired, the copper body enamel decoration piece will swing under the influence of wind in daily life, and then lead to the wear between it and the metal hanging ring, so that the oxidation protective layer on the surface of the copper body enamel decoration piece is easily damaged, and then the life of the copper body enamel decoration piece is reduced, and the technical innovation is carried out on the basis of the existing copper body enamel decoration for ancient building cultural relics restoration. CONTENT OF UTILITY MODEL
[0003] The utility model is to provide copper body enamel decoration for ancient building cultural relics restoration to solve the problem in the prior art.
[0004] In order to achieve the above object, the utility model provides the following technical scheme: copper body enamel decoration for ancient building cultural relics restoration, comprising:
[0005] Copper body, the front and back sides of the copper body are drawn with enamel patterns, the front side of the copper body is provided with a hanging hole, and the hanging hole is provided with a protection assembly.
[0006] Preferably, the protection assembly comprises an isolation sleeve, a group of first isolation pads are arranged on the front and back sides of the isolation sleeve, through holes are formed in the front side of the first isolation pad and the isolation sleeve, a second isolation pad is arranged on the top of the two groups of first isolation pads, positioning columns are evenly arranged on the front and back sides of the isolation sleeve, insertion holes are evenly formed on the opposite sides of the two groups of first isolation pads, and the positioning columns are inserted into the insertion holes.
[0007] Preferably, the isolation sleeve is located in the hanging hole of the copper body, and the two groups of first isolation pads are located on the front and back sides of the copper body.
[0008] Preferably, the second isolation pad is located on the top of the copper body, the first isolation pad and the second isolation pad are designed in one piece, the isolation sleeve and the positioning column are designed in one piece, and the first isolation pad, the second isolation pad, the isolation sleeve and the positioning column are all made of transparent rubber material.
[0009] Preferably, the surface of the copper body is covered with an oxidation protective layer, and the surface of the oxidation protective layer is sprayed with a corrosion protective layer through transparent anticorrosive paint.
[0010] Preferably, the surface of the enamel pattern is sprayed with an enamel protective layer through transparent enamel protective agent.
[0011] Compared with the prior art, the utility model has the advantages that:
[0012] The utility model discloses, when the protection assembly needs to be replaced when aging, can directly pull outwards first isolation pad and isolation cover separation, with this can separate the protection assembly and copper fetus and replace, the metal hanging ring is passed through the through -hole of protection assembly, and is fixed under the eaves of ancient building, through protection assembly, copper fetus and metal hanging ring are isolated, with this prevent the abrasion between copper fetus and metal hanging ring.
[0013] Through the mutual cooperation of the oxidation protection layer and the corrosion protection layer, the surface of the copper fetus is double-isolated and protected, and through the enamel protection layer, the enamel pattern is isolated and protected, so that the corrosion resistance of the entire copper fetus enamel decoration piece is improved, and the decoration life is prolonged. [0020] Please refer to Figures 1-4 The application discloses a copper body enamel decoration for repairing ancient buildings and cultural relics, which comprises a copper body, enamel patterns 11 drawn on the front and back sides of the copper body, a hanging hole provided through the front side of the copper body, and a protection assembly arranged in the hanging hole.
[0021] The surface of the copper body is covered with an oxidation protection layer 21, the surface of the oxidation protection layer 21 is sprayed with a corrosion protection layer 22 through transparent anticorrosive paint, and the surface of the enamel patterns 11 is sprayed with an enamel protection layer 2 through transparent enamel protection agent.
[0022] Working principle: the positioning column 15 is inserted into the first isolation pad 12 hole, so that the first isolation pad 12 is stable outside the isolation sleeve 14, and then the installation of the protection assembly is completed. A small amount of glue can be applied between the isolation sleeve 14 and the first isolation pad 12 for reinforcement. When the protection assembly needs to be replaced due to aging, the first isolation pad 12 can be directly pulled outwards to separate from the isolation sleeve 14, so that the protection assembly can be separated from the copper body 1 for replacement. The metal hanging ring is passed through the through hole of the protection assembly and fixed under the eaves of the ancient building. The copper body 1 is isolated from the metal hanging ring by the protection assembly, so as to prevent wear between the copper body 1 and the metal hanging ring. The surface of the copper body 1 is double isolated and protected by the oxidation protection layer 21 and the corrosion protection layer 22. The enamel pattern 11 is isolated and protected by the enamel protection layer 2, so as to improve the corrosion resistance of the entire copper body enamel decoration piece, and prolong the decoration life.
